Better whips will mean more durability, which is nice -- having your toy break in the middle of play makes a sad panda. It also means different sensations; I won't say better, but every type of toy has a unique sensation. If you like what you got, I'd say buy a few spares and do the happy dance. There's no reason at all you have to use expensive stuff.

As already mentioned, if you're willing to shop around or consider assembling something on your own, there are a lot of ways to make cheap gear.
